Anti-corrosive performance of epoxy coatings containing various nano-particles for splash zone applications

Various formulations of epoxy nano-composites coating were developed by incorporating the nanoparticles
(NPs) of ZnO, ZrO2, and SiO2 (2 wt%) in commercially available epoxy resin as the matrix phase. Direct incorporation
method was used for the addition of NPs in epoxy matrix. High-speed mechanical stirring and ultra-sonication
were carried out to facilitate the dispersion of NPs in the presence of acetone used as a solvent. Coating of neat epoxy
and NPs (ZnO, ZrO2, SiO2) doped coating was applied on mild steel substrate for corrosion analysis. The effect of the
incorporation of various NPs on anti-corrosive properties of the epoxy/nano-composite coatings was investigated by
electrochemical impedance spectroscopy technique. The experimental results showed an improvement in the anticorrosive
properties for EZr coatings as compared with pristine and other nanocomposite coating samples.
